Output 8853138c5cccacfacf8dca5d7f3692c112dc70b87e3681e0f19bc9d016a2a25e:12

value
559060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73ec93cb84d10f0a39c5fdf3cf541ebf23946f0f OP_EQUAL
address
3CFy3HUguWgsMjrzBeKfLprC1njWDrKPng
transaction
8853138c5cccacfacf8dca5d7f3692c112dc70b87e3681e0f19bc9d016a2a25e
spent
true